Abstract

The traditional approach in analyzing network reliability is to determine end-to-end availability for a few reference connections. A major benefit of this approach is a reduction in computation time. This approach is valid for the traditional electrical telecommunication network because major failure contributions generally come from the station (or node) equipment boxes.
